Sir, – Judges do not believe they will replaced by AI in 10 years, but are less confident if the time frame is moved to 30 years (“Judges do not believe their jobs will be taken over by artificial intelligence – yet”, News, May 2nd).
Judges should be human. The law is a code and and having it judged by a computer code would be a travesty. If a human judge is inhumane and cruel that is a failure of the justice system. He or she should not have been made a judge. If an AI judge is inhuman and merciless, that is to be expected. – Yours, etc,
